Pokekara is a karaoke app available in the Japanese market. I worked with other designers to improve the Search and Play Music experience. In addition, I also designed the mascot for marketing use.

Challenge

Problem:

Pokekara needed to stand out from competitors and boost organic engagement in a crowded market.

Action:

I developed a comprehensive mascot identity, transforming it into animations, online emojis, stickers, and other merchandise.

Result:

These initiatives resonated with millions of daily active users and contributed to Pokekara achieving the No. 1 ranking on both the Japanese App Store and Google Play overall rankings.
